Cerros Mariachi is a hill in Sonora, Northern Mexico and has an elevation of 321 metres. Cerros Mariachi is situated nearby to the locality Cañada de los Negros, as well as near El Mariachi.| Tap on a place to explore it |

The Hermosillo Sonora Mexico Temple is a temple of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ints in Hermosillo, Sonora, Mexico. The intent to build the temple was announced by the [[First Presidency |First Presidency on July 20, 1998.
